List of Father Brown episodes

Father Brown is a British television detective period drama which began airing on BBC One on 14 January 2013. It features Mark Williams as the eponymous crime-solving Roman Catholic priest. The series is loosely based on short stories by G. K. Chesterton.

As of 17 January 2020, 90 episodes of Father Brown have aired, concluding the eighth series. A ninth series has been commissioned for broadcast in 2021.[1]
